Leonardo Balerdi is an Argentinian defender who has been making a name for himself with his consistent performances for Marseille in Ligue 1 this season. Balerdi began his professional career with Boca Juniors in Argentina before making the move to Europe in 2018, signing for Borussia Dortmund in Germany. Balerdi decided to leave Germany after two years and signed with Marseille in 2020. Since arriving at the club, Balerdi has been an integral part of their defence and has been a key figure in their impressive defensive record this season. He has been able to read the game well, making crucial interceptions and tackles to help the team maintain their solid defensive shape. Additionally, he has been able to contribute going forward too, as he is comfortable on the ball and can start attacks with accurate passing. Below, we look at some of his stats for Marseille in Ligue 1.

Balerdi usually plays as a left centre-back, but on rare occasions, he can also slot in as the right-back. The viz above shows the percentile rank of the player’s stats compared to other centre-backs in Ligue 1 in 2022/23. He has played 21 matches and ranks in the top 97.1 percentile for defensive duels per 90 minutes and in the top 83.0 percentile for defensive duels won. Other areas where the player does well include accurate passes per 90 and positioning.

Defensive contributions

As a left centre-back, Balerdi’s defensive gameplay is decent. From the viz above we can see that his average position along the defensive line is well within his own half. The player makes 12.36 recoveries and 5.18 interceptions per match. Furthermore, he contests 9.18 defensive duels with a win rate of 73.1%. As for aerial duels, the centre-back contests 3.9 per match with a 47.5% win rate.

He has a shot block xG of 0.56 and has blocked 16 shots. Most of his blocks have come from inside the box, but some are also outside the box. He averages 2.52 clearances per 90 minutes and 0.8 shot blocks per 90 minutes. The centre-back makes maximum tackles in the defensive third, in and around the box.

High pressing tendencies

The above viz represents the overall high regains made by Leonardo Balerdi for Marseille in Ligue 1 in 2022/23. It can be seen that the player makes movements up the pitch in order to put pressure on the opposition. As a centre-back, Balerdi has made a total of 19 counter-pressing recoveries in the middle and final third of the pitch. Additionally, he has made seven high regains and three dangerous recoveries for Marseille this season.

Passing efficiency

The above viz is a representation of the passes made by the player. It can be seen that most of his work rate is again on the right side of the defence and in the middle third of the pitch. The player makes 49.59 passes per 90 with 89.8% accuracy. Additionally, he makes 5.17 passes into the final third on average. Balerdi makes 17.16 forward passes with 77% accuracy per 90 minutes. He possesses fine passing ability in terms of passes attempted and pass accuracy. He provides a trustworthy option in defence as a man with plenty of experience in the back and often tends to show maturity on the pitch by leading the backline. He makes progressive passes as well and makes contributions by making central and through passes to the midfielders.

Overall, Balerdi has been one of the key players behind Marseilles success in defence this season, and his presence has been a huge boost for the team. He is a player who is continuing to develop and improve, and it will be interesting to see how he continues to progress in the future
